Understanding Zam Zam Water:
Zam Zam water is sourced from the Zam Zam well in Mecca,
located within the Masjid al-Haram, the holiest mosque in Islam. According to
Islamic tradition, the well dates back to the time of Prophet Ibrahim (Abraham)
and holds a unique and sacred status. Pilgrims visiting Mecca often bring Zam
Zam water back home, and its consumption is associated with spiritual and
healing properties.

Certifications and Documentation:
Authentic Zam Zam water is often accompanied by
certifications and documentation that verify its origin and purity. Reputable
suppliers will provide these documents upon request. Look for certifications
from relevant authorities in Saudi Arabia, such as the Saudi Geological Survey,
which oversees the Zam Zam well and ensures the quality of the water.
Physical Characteristics:
Examining the physical characteristics of Zam Zam water can
also help in determining its authenticity. Genuine Zam Zam water is known for
its distinct taste, odor, and composition. While these sensory aspects may not
be foolproof methods, they can serve as initial indicators. Additionally,
authentic Zam Zam water may have unique packaging features, such as holographic
seals or specific labeling, which counterfeit products often lack.
